Robert Lewandowski was among the best players in the world when Barcelona moved to sign him in 2022. The Polish international was coming off multiple spectacular seasons with Bayern Munich, with his last spell there ending in 35 league goals in 34 games. While absolutely outrageous, that was not his best season at Bayern. During the 2020/21 season, under Hansi Flick, Lewandowski ended up with a whopping 41 goals (and seven assists) in a mere 29 games, averaging a goal every hour.
